Building of the Ferris wheel was in 1998. On 10 October 1999, the construction was lifted up. The opening was delayed for guests resulting from technical problems until 9 March 2000. The inventors had their concept throughout a contest for the Millennium celebrations introduced up by the British Parliament. The London Eye was initially meant to be just for a restricted period of 5 years. Given it's nice success however it has survived to this day.
The London Eye has 32 fully air-conditioned virtually entirely of glass formed gondolas, each capable of accommodating as much as 25 people. The glass gondolas in two rotating rings are mounted so that the gondolas are all the time in the horizontal. The gondolas are outdoors of the wheel, permitting an nearly unrestricted view. The wheel rotates at a velocity of 0.26 m / s and takes a turn for about 30-40 minutes. Because the wheel has virtually by no means stops, the passengers get on whereas it is rotating, and it stops only to allow, for example, wheelchair access. It is powered by 4 items, each with 4 wheels and tires, that are set by the wheel rim and so they rotate it. Overall, therefore 4x4 = 16 drive wheels. If the visibility is optimal, one can from the Ferris seel as much as forty km away, and amongst other things to just outdoors London it could see Windsor Castle.

The Ferris wheel was designed by architects David Marks and Julia Barfield. The design of the automobiles is from Nick Bailey . The general construction was carried out by the Dutch design firm Hollandia. The axis of rotation and the pillars were created by the Czech engineering firm Skoda. The capsules and the stabilization system is from the French company Sigma. The drive was developed by the Bosch subsidiary Bosch Rexroth. On 10 September 1999 the Dutch specialist firm Smit Tak with one of the largest floating cranes on the earth assembled the wheel of the London Eye to erect it, but the try failed. Only a month later the wheel was first raised by 60 degrees. It took one other week to be able to carry it into its remaining position.
The Merlin Entertainments Group owns and operates the Ferris wheel, and is sponsored by British Airways . On the opening in 1999 it was nonetheless part of the Tussauds Group and British Airways and Marks Barfield Architects family together. In 2006 Tussaud acquired the shares of the opposite house owners in 2007 after which itself received taken over by Merlin.
Currently it's the third largest Ferris wheel within the world. By 4 January 2004 it was renamed the London Eye, the tallest Ferris wheel on the earth, however was then beaten by a brand new one hundred sixty-meter-high Ferris wheel, the " Star of Nanchang in Nanchang China, which, in turn, with the opening of the Singapore Flyer on 1 March 2008 was also crushed as the largest Ferris wheel in the world.
